Medicare provider numbers are obtained by submitting the suitable Medicare provider/provider enrollment purposes to the appropriate Medicare middleman. Medicare enrollment functions can be submitted by utilizing paper forms such because the CMS-855I for a person provider, the CMS-855B for a gaggle/provider, and other forms. Providers may also use the online application by way of the Provider Enrollment, Chain, and Ownership System . Different provider sorts have various enrollment necessities so turn into conversant in what your carrier must correctly enroll you and/or your group.

Many Medicare Supplement plans don't cover benefits like vision, dental, eyeglasses, listening to aids, or prescription drug coverage. If you want prescription drugs, you would need to enroll in a standalone Medicare Part D prescription drug plan. Medicare Advantage, also referred to as Part C, replaces Original Medicare if you enroll in coverage. Advantage plans are offered by private insurance companies and are required to cover every little thing you would have with Original Medicare.

If you didn't enroll in prescription drug coverage throughout IEP, you possibly can sign up for prescription drug coverage through the Annual Election Period that runs every year from October 15 to December 7. Medicare prescription drug coverage is elective and does not occur routinely. Medicare prescription drug plans and Medicare Advantage plans can be found by way of private insurers.

When you start Part B, it triggers a particular election interval that allows you to make changes to your coverage outdoors of the usual enrollment periods. If you don’t enroll in Medicare Part B during your initial enrollment period, you could have one other chance each year to enroll throughout a “common enrollment interval” from January 1 via March 31. You can sign up for Medicare Part B at any time that you've coverage by way of present or lively employment. Or you can join Medicare through the eight-month Special Enrollment Period that starts when your employer or union group coverage ends or you cease working . If you get COBRA or retiree benefits after you cease working, keep in mind that this doesn’t rely as coverage based on current employment; ensure you don’t wait until your COBRA benefits finish to enroll in Medicare Part B.
